Block

#21,241,525
Block Number
21,241,525 @ 03/25/2025, 23:12:00
Status
Finalized
ID
0x01441eb58089101735e19ea381b4174c7bd5dfcab691689bd41c7b070ca52319
Transactions
Gas Used
4561730/40000000 (11.40% Used)
Total Score
2,073,970,030 (+98)
Rewards
17.67 VTHO